What companies run services between Ulm, Germany and Starnberger See, Germany?

You can take a train from Ulm Hauptbahnhof to Starnberg Nord via Pasing in around 1h 34m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Ulm to Starnberg via Munich central bus station, Hackerbrücke, Donnersbergerbrücke, and Donnersbergerbrücke in around 2h 46m.
